  • How Do I enable Safe Asynchronous Write With NFS?

    - by Joe Swanson
    The NFSv3 documentation talks alot about the concept of "safe asynchronous writes" (last bullet of A1): http://nfs.sourceforge.net/#section_a This is NOT referring to the sync/async option in the server exports file (as the async option in the exports file is NOT safe). As I understand it, safe asynchronous writes is a hybrid between the sync/async exports option. It allows for a server to reply back without flushing to stable storage immediately, but the client will not remove the write request from cache until it has received confirmation that it has been committed to stable storage (and also detects if the server looses power/reboots). I believe that this option is set on the client side, but I have not come across any documentation that shows how to do this. Any ideas?

  • Is IMAP (un)subscribe meant to work accross mail clients?

    - by equaeghe
    I read my IMAP-mail on different computers/mail clients. I wanted to unsubscribe from the majority of my folders in Outlook. Later, I noticed that on another computer, where I use Thunderbird, I was also unsubscribed from those folders as well. This is not what I wanted (at all), so I subscribed again under Thunderbird. The effect was that I also got subscribed again under Outlook. So I guess this means (un)subscribing to IMAP folders is an account-coupled thing, not a per-client thing. Is there a way to achieve (un)subscribing per client?

  • Looking for 'WinHlp32.exe compatible' replacement for free redistribution under vista and windows 7

    - by richardboon
    Our software installs a package of legacy software for the client, some of it has old hlp file from 3rd party vendor requiring winhlp32.exe (note: we have no legal right to modify the hlp). Those client may only have cd/dvd and might not have internet access, etc. So I need a free 'WinHlp32.exe compatible' replacement for our redistribution under vista and windows 7. Background of problem: -Microsoft stopped including the 32-bit Help file viewer in Windows releases beginning with Windows Vista and Windows Server 2008. -Starting with the release of Windows Vista and Windows Server 2008, third-party software developers are no longer authorized to redistribute WinHlp32.exe with their programs. http://support.microsoft.com/kb/917607
